Now with the problem..no it is not normal. If the Jeep is older look for frayed wires, bad connections. Etc
Check all ground straps, battery to body, body to frame, engine to frame, engine to body.....
Pull the tail lamps apart and look for corroded sockets, same on the front....
Bet you find the problem is corroded contacts and bad grounds. [img]images/graemlins/burnout.gif[/img]
